SoftBank Files for Record ¥1 Trillion Retail Bond to Fund OpenAI Stakes

Retail bond proceeds will fund SoftBank’s $60 billion‑plus OpenAI commitments while sharpening attention on a March 2027 refinancing deadline.

Overview

  • SoftBank disclosed Monday that it has filed to sell a seven‑year, ¥1 trillion retail bond expected to price on Sept. 4 with an indicative coupon of 4.3%–4.9%.
  • The new offering is the group’s third retail tranche in 2026 and would bring total retail fundraising this year to roughly ¥1.68 trillion after April and June sales.
  • SoftBank says the proceeds will help pay for its more than $60 billion in commitments to OpenAI and for investments in data‑center capacity to run AI workloads.
  • The company still relies on a $40 billion unsecured bridge loan that matures in March 2027, leaving a near‑term refinancing milestone that the bond sale helps address.
  • S&P upgraded SoftBank’s outlook to stable and affirmed BB+ in July as key ratios improved, but analysts note concentrated exposure to a private OpenAI stake and the bridge timing remain material risks.
